#229dd3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#229dd3 is composed of 13.3% red, 61.6%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 25.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 198.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 48%. #229dd3 color hex could be obtained by blending #44ffff with #003ba7.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

● #229dd3 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#229dd3 has RGB values of R:34, G:157,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 2268627.
